Here's how to add shapes in Adobe
- Locate the drawing tools by looking for the floating toolbar on the left side of your Adobe Acrobat interface.
- Click on the 'Draw Freehand' icon within the floating toolbar to access the shape options.
- Browse through the available shape options and select the specific shape you want to insert into your document.
- Position your mouse cursor on the PDF page where you want to place the shape.
- Click and drag with your mouse to draw the shape directly onto the PDF page, then release to finalize the placement.
